#include<iostream>
using namespace std;
int main()
{
char a[21];
scanf("%s", a);
int l = strlen(a);
for (int i = 0; i < l; i++)
{
if (a[i] >= 'A' && a[i] <= 'Z')
a[i] += 32;
else
a[i] -= 32;
}
printf("%s\n", a);
system("pause");
return 0;
}
//总结,对于大小写字母转换问题 关键在于要知道大小写字母ASI码间相差32
//即 A+32=a